Handover — Schemadex event registry

Mira, here's where things stand before I go offline. The registry pod on the Veltros cluster was restarted yesterday after the compatibility checker stalled on a malformed Avro submission from the billing-events team. I've quarantined that subject and pinged them. Watch the validation queue depth; anything over 200 means the checker thread is wedged again. Restart is safe — state lives in the backing store. The current service configuration values are listed below.

config for tagep-yajef:
ulawyn:
  log_level: error
  metrics_host: metrics.ulawyn.lumiclabs.internal
  pin: 0564
  pool_size: 32

Ticket: Bucketeer assignment service returning 401s in staging. Root cause: the env file was copied from the Fenwick sandbox and still points at the retired experiment store. New folks, note that assignment hashing won't work without a valid store credential, so fallback bucketing silently kicks in. Fix: correct the store URL, then add the store's access secret on the very next line.

vault entry, kagep-yajeg: COURIER_KEY5=da097

Welcome to the Mailtrellis plugin program. Your plugin can subscribe to bounce events from our bounce processor, which classifies hard and soft bounces and suppresses repeat offenders automatically. Sandbox credentials are provisioned on day one. If you ever lose sandbox access, the recovery flow will prompt you for the passphrase below.

strongbox words: belath-holwyn-quenir-pelmir-istix-quenius-quenix-pramir-pelax-belax

## Build Provenance — ChronoGate Reader Firmware

The ChronoGate timing-chip reader firmware is built reproducibly from the pinned toolchain in the Larkspur build container. Each release is traceable to a signed commit and archived manifest. Future maintainers should verify the manifest hash before flashing units deployed at the Veldmoor Marathon. The provenance token for this build follows.

pipeline stamp: htk9_ce63042d9